How Do You Make Words Bigger While Browsing?

0

If you are tired of squinting while surfing the internet, you can make the words bigger. Whether you are using the Internet Explorer or Firefox, it’s really easy to increase the text size. Step 1 If you are using Mozilla Firefox, go to the View menu, select Zoom, and then select Zoom In. Zooming in will increase the size of everything on the page, including pictures. If you only want to make the text bigger, check the Zoom Text Only option under zoom menu first. Step 2 If you are using Internet Explorer, go to the View menu, select Text Size, and then select whatever size font you would prefer. Step 3 Whether you are using Internet Explorer or Firefox, you can also use a shortcut (Ctrl++) to make the words bigger. Hold the Ctrl button and then press + twice. To reduce the text size use Ctrl– or go back to the View menu.
